In short
The legal test is the same everywhere: assess the risk and control it so far as is reasonably practicable. What differs by sector is what you actually have on site, how much of it you control, and what happens to people if it fails. That is what these pages are about.
A warehouse has space and can separate. A housing association has neither space nor control over what residents buy. A recycling operator receives damaged cells as its raw material. Those are genuinely different problems, and generic guidance helps none of them.

What every sector has in common
Three things hold regardless of setting, and they are worth stating once here rather than eight times:
- Count energy, not items. Watt-hours determine what a failure releases. Two packs the same physical size can differ several times over. How to work it out.
- Where charging happens is the highest-value decision available, and it is usually free. Off escape routes, away from sleeping accommodation.
- Decide where a damaged pack goes before you find one. Every sector improvises this, and improvising it is how a swollen pack ends up beside a fire door.
